Family Support Specialist
Children's Mercy
Community Programs MSWs (Family Support Specialists) provide home-based family support to pregnant and postpartum women and their families enrolled in the TIES Program (Team for Infants Exposed to Substance use). Specialists partner with families to develop individualized, trauma-informed, culturally appropriate services to promote child development, social and emotional well-being and healthier family functioning. Services will include in-home support for substance use treatment, child development education and parenting support, connection to health and behavioral health services, crisis intervention and supportive counseling, and coordination of services with multiple community agencies. Family Support Specialists work jointly with Patient Resource Specialists to provide comprehensive support to families.

Supervisor, Social Work - TIES Program
Children's Mercy
The TIES (Team for Infants Exposed to Substance use) Program is an intensive, home-based model to work with pregnant and postpartum women and their families affected by maternal substance use. The TIES Program Supervisor is responsible for administrative, clinical, and reflective supervision of all TIES clinical staff. In addition, the Supervisor is an integral part of the TIES and Community Programs management teams and consistently works to identify, plan and implement strategies to enhance services to families.

Nurse Family Partnership Nurse Home Visitor
Shawnee County Health Department
Provides services according to the Nurse-Family Partnership model of
home visitation. Assesses physical, emotional, social, and environmental strengths and risks for the family. Builds therapeutic relationship with families. Performs health, development and nutrition assessments on pregnant women, infants, and toddlers. Provides support, education, and guidance to the family, and makes appropriate referrals based on findings if needed. Focuses intervention on improved pregnancy outcomes, enhanced child health development, and improved maternal life course development.

Healthy Babies Community Health Nurse II
Sedgwick County Health Department
Provide direct in-home prenatal and parenting education and support to women and families in Sedgwick County with a focus on the reduction of infant mortality, low birth weight, and prematurity among high-risk mothers. Education and support is both provided at in home and doctors office visits as provider will accompany clients to Well child visits assisting with navigation in the healthcare system. This position works to meet the mission of the Sedgwick County Health Department by promoting the wellness of Sedgwick County residents through the Healthy Babies Program’s focus on reduction of infant mortality, low birth weight, and prematurity among high risk moms.

Parent Educator
Topeka Public Schools Parents as Teachers
Parents as Teachers (PAT) is a primary prevention and parenting education program designed to serve all families with children from prenatal through kindergarten in the Topeka Public Schools District. The Parent Educator is a professional responsible for delivering all PAT services: personalized home visits, developmental screenings, playgroups, presentations, recruitment, and group meetings.
